Good product for 1G flash drive
I need to use 1or 2G flash drives for one of my home embroidery machines, the other can take 8G.(Check your owner's manual or dealer,to see how many G's your specific machine will take)I have found the 8G of this brand excellent in my bigger embroidery machine,transfers from website with noproblems and produces on flash drive same, quickly with no errors.I used the 1G yesterday on my smaller machine, the size it will take, and found it worked excellently, doing both operations. Love it folds in for protection. Durabilty,good.. The price is excellent,also. Just what I needed..Will order again.

Great value; not all created equal
Review is for 10-Pack 16GB USB 2.0 variant.The good:All ten drives test OK.All ten drives have excellent read speeds, averaging 34.1 MB/s with little variation.The bad:Write speeds and access times are generally bad, but inconsistent.No matter how you count, 15,728,640,000 bytes is not 16 GB.Testing was done with gnome-disk-utility on a USB 2.0 port. All 10 devices identify as "TONPHA USB 2.0 Classic". As mentioned, read speeds were consistently excellent, but write speeds varied. Seven of the ten drives averaged 4.8 MB/s write, while the other three averaged 8.4 MB/s. Access times also varied and trended with write times: the slow drives averaged 5.18 ms, while the fast drives averaged 1.57 ms. Attached screenshots show representative results for each group. For reference, there is also a result for a USB 3.0 SanDisk 128 GB Ultra Flair (33.2 MB/s read, 20.8 MB/s write, 1.04 ms access).I bought these primarily to use as bootable drives (Debian, MemTest86, Clonezilla, etc.). I expect they will be perfect for this purpose. The slow writes will hurt a little, but the fast reads will make up for it. Longevity is a question mark, but at this price point, I don't care too much.Physical build quality is decent. Packaging and literature are surprisingly good. I like that they came with perfectly sized labels.
